Output 572e6e9933d26a1da97086cdc6485f9fab9cdb7e540b03e50a92e78142b348ae:1

value
25234355
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0b0395c862de556fa1fd504cb52bf8cbbb29320 OP_EQUAL
address
3KFrmdxpV33cPwDb81W7uwF6FYrXiUpqxF
transaction
572e6e9933d26a1da97086cdc6485f9fab9cdb7e540b03e50a92e78142b348ae
confirmations
142172
spent
true